Why Wasps Are More Dangerous Than You Think
Rising Populations
Warmer winters in the UK have allowed more queens to survive hibernation, leading to higher numbers of nests each spring and summer. This means infestations are becoming more frequent.
Medical Risks
While most stings cause short-term pain, an estimated 3–5% of the UK population may suffer serious allergic reactions (anaphylaxis). For these individuals, one sting can be life-threatening.
Aggressive Species
Essex has seen an increase in German wasps and common wasps, which are highly defensive of their nests. Unlike bees, they can sting repeatedly, making untrained DIY removal extremely risky.

How to Reduce the Risk of Wasp Infestations
Even with expert help available, prevention remains the best strategy:
- Seal Entry Points – Block gaps in roofs, vents, and window frames where queens may start nests.
- Check Early in Spring – Look for small, golf-ball-sized nests. They are easier and cheaper to remove at this stage.
- Manage Waste Properly – Keep bins sealed and outdoor eating areas clean, as sugary drinks and food scraps attract wasps.
- Maintain Gardens – Trim shrubs and trees where nests may develop, especially in quiet, sheltered corners.
- Avoid DIY Nest Removal – Disturbing a nest can trigger hundreds of wasps to attack at once. Always call professionals.

The Seasonal Cycle of Wasps – Why Timing Matters
- Spring – Queens emerge from hibernation and build small nests. Early removal is cheapest and safest.
- Summer – Colonies grow rapidly, often reaching thousands of wasps by late July. Aggression peaks during this period.
- Autumn – As food sources decline, wasps become more aggressive and likely to invade homes.
- Winter – Most wasps die, but new queens hibernate, ready to restart the cycle next spring.
Understanding this cycle helps homeowners and businesses plan timely pest control.
